We have quite a unique setup at our company. We currently have Cognos BI and Cognos Express on two different servers installed.
Cognos BI was OEM'ed with our new ERP package and we started deploying the standard ERP data warehouse BI modules via Cognos BI.
Beginning of the year we invested in Cognos Express Xcelerator to provide us with a driver based budgeting solution. At that time the pricing seemed very attractive and the only issue was that the instance will be limited to 100 users only.
Fast forward to today where our users start to request drill through to transaction level.
First of all, our company do not support Excel 2003 or 2007 and has already started with Office 2010 roll-out. So the Xcelerator client can't be installed on the user's local machines.
So, we tried to implement the drill through on the TM1Web, but once you are at transaction level, you can't do anything with the output, except view it.
Now we are trying to create a data source of our TM1 cube in Cognos BI 10.1.
But we are getting security errors when we use a sign-on username and password.
The other issue is that we do not know how to configure Cognos Express as an external name space in the Cognos BI configuration.
We would appreciate any help in getting us to configure our Cognos Express Xcelerator (TM1) as a data source in our Cognos BI 10.1

I think you need to read the contract you signed when you bought CX. I don't believe you can legally publish Excelerator cubes to BI. You may find a technical workround, but you are at risk from an IBM compliance audit - and you wouldn't enjoy that.
Your options are probably to migrate to TM1 Enterprise (pricey) or to export the data and structures from Excelerator to flat files and populate a set of warehouse tables, then build the BI stuff over the top.

As David says, under the Cognos Express licensing the TM1 cubes can be used only with Cognos Express reporter, not full feature Cognos BI.fstrydom wrote:We currently have Cognos BI and Cognos Express on two different servers installed.
Cognos BI was OEM'ed with our new ERP package and we started deploying the standard ERP data warehouse BI modules via Cognos BI
You should also check that the OEM version of Cognos BI can be used on databases outside of the ERP data warehouse, OEM licenses often have restrictions on their use.
